Amen to that. Unfortunately we are a victim of our own success. As we became more wealthy we decided we could pay others to do it cheaper, so we did. Now we are faced with the grim truth that a lot of our skilled workforce have now passed on without passing the knowledge and skills on down through the generations. We are now left with a country that has lost a lot of the skills needed to be able to manufacture on a mass scale. The problem is now, the Chineese etc are begining to catch up to where our mentality was in the late 70's. The "common" workers are begining to want more from their lives, wages are increasing and as a result prices are going up with them. We are getting to the point where if we had the infrastructure in place we could now be manufacturing on a comparable level with regards to qty and price. We don't have that now, so we are forced to increase our spending on importing the goods we once could have made. An example of this is the cost of bearings, over the past year they have more than doubled in price. The new competitor for bearings is now Russia so I am told. The quality is certainly there, and the price back to 2010 china prices.

Investing in science is now more important than ever for the UK IMO. If that be into space etc then so be it, there is certainly a lot of money to be made out of this frontier. Okay, maybe we can't make money out of making widgets, but maybe we can look to making money out of widgets in space or sending them there.
